Abstract
Considering the actual situation, the converter-grid systems, including three-phase grid-connected converter and ac grid, mostly operate in the case of unbalance. However, most of the literature models and analyzes the balance situation, that is, the symmetric grid impedance and balanced three-phase grid voltage. In this paper, based on the harmonic transfer matrix (HTM) theory, a unified analytical expression of output admittance matrix of grid-connected converter is derived in detail, which can be used in both balance and unbalance cases. According to the relationship of interconnected system, the additional frequency components in unbalance conditions are uniformly equivalent to the frequency components existing in balance. Then the reduced-order output admittance model of the grid-connected converter and grid impedance model are established. Meanwhile, the correctness of the model is verified respectively. Based on the reduced-order model, the influencing factors of converter-grid systems under balanced and unbalanced conditions are analyzed.
